Publication number: 20230038449Abstract: A shipping assistance device which enables a delivery service operator to quickly confirm that the size of an item has been properly measured and there is no need to re-measure the size, and proceed to operations for transportation, comprises a table to place items, upper and side shooting devices for shooting images of an item on the table, a storage chamber for storing items, front-facing and upward-facing displays a printer for printing a shipping label, and a processing controller configured to measure the size of the item on the table based on shot images, determine if the item is acceptable to be put in the storage chamber based on the measured size, display a determination result on the displays, and when the item is determined acceptable, instruct the printer to print a shipping label with an acceptance signature for the item.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 15, 2021Publication date: February 9, 2023Applicant: PANASONIC IN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CO., LTD.Inventors: Kazuhiro TSUBOTA, Yota TOGUCHI, Yasuki YAMAKAWA

Patent number: 10366477Abstract: A method for processing an image includes receiving an input image having distortion, receiving position information input by a user on the received input image, generating a first image by correcting the input image having distortion, and translating a position on the input image having distortion indicated by the received position information into a position on the generated first image. The method further includes setting, on the generated first image, a first mask area having a predetermined shape and including the position on the generated first image translated from the position on the input image having distortion, and performing mask processing on the set first mask area on the generated first image.Type: GrantFiled: November 3, 2017Date of Patent: July 30, 2019Assignee: PANASONIC IN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CO., LTD.Invent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Ryoji Ogino, Kojiro Iwasaki, Mikio Morioka

Patent number: 10249058Abstract: A three-dimensional information reconstraction device includes a corresponding point detector that detects a plurality of corresponding point pairs to which a first feature point included in a first image captured by a first image capturing device and a second feature point included in a second image captured by a second image capturing device correspond, and a three-dimensional coordinate deriver that, based on the plurality of corresponding point pairs, reconstructs three-dimensional coordinates to which the first feature point is inverse-projected.Type: GrantFiled: December 14, 2015Date of Patent: April 2, 2019Assignee: PANASONIC IN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CO., LTD.Invent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Kenya Uomori

Patent number: 10083513Abstract: The information presentation device has an image acquisition unit, a parameter deriving unit, an abnormality detection unit, and the presentation unit. The image acquisition unit acquires a first image which is captured by a first imaging device and a second image which is captured by a second imaging device. The parameter deriving unit derives parameters for deriving three-dimensional coordinates from the first image and the second image. The abnormality detection unit determines presence or absence of an abnormality in a relative positional relationship or a relative relationship of pose between the first imaging device and the second imaging device according to the derived parameters. In a case where an abnormality is determined, the presentation unit presents warning information including an instruction that there is an abnormality.Type: GrantFiled: April 11, 2016Date of Patent: September 25, 2018Assignee: PANASONIC IN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CO., LTD.Invent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Kenya Uomori

Patent number: 9836829Abstract: An image display method includes displaying an input image having distortion on a display, receiving a plurality of points which are specified on the displayed input image in response to a user input, calculating a first processing area having a first shape according to the points specified on the displayed input image so that the first shape becomes a predetermined shape when distortion of the first processing area having the first shape is corrected, and displaying the first processing area having the first shape together with the input image on the display.Type: GrantFiled: June 15, 2016Date of Patent: December 5, 2017Assignee: PANASONIC IN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CO., LTD.Invent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Ryoji Ogino, Kojiro Iwasaki, Mikio Morioka

Patent number: 9396529Abstract: An example image processor provides a distortion-corrected image including a masking area having improved appearance. The image processor includes: a masking area retaining section that retains a masking area set for an image having distortion; a masking execution section that performs masking processing for the image having distortion using the masking area retained in the masking area retaining section; a distortion correction section that corrects the image having distortion that is subjected to the masking processing using a correction parameter for correcting distortion of the image having distortion; and a masking area shaping section that shapes the masking area of the corrected image into a predetermined shape.Type: GrantFiled: July 28, 2014Date of Patent: July 19, 2016Assignee: PANASONIC IN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CO., LTD.Invent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Ryoji Ogino, Kojiro Iwasaki, Mikio Morioka

Patent number: 8928778Abstract: A camera device includes an imaging unit generating an imaging area image in which an imaging area is captured from above, and a display-image generation unit generating a display image of an imaging object moving in the imaging area by use of an clipped image clipped from the imaging area image. In this case, an clipping reference position P corresponding to the imaging object in the imaging area image is determined, and a reference distance r between an imaging reference position O corresponding to the imaging unit and the clipping reference position P in the imaging area image is calculated. When the reference distance r is short, a rotation angle ?NEW for rotating the clipped image in generating the display image is calculated based on a reference angle ? corresponding to an inclination of the imaging object in the imaging area image and the reference distance r.Type: GrantFiled: December 20, 2011Date of Patent: January 6, 2015Assignee: Panasonic CorporationInvent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Junya Kuwada

Patent number: 8179395Abstract: An image special effect apparatus capable of realizing the illumination effects corresponding to various image special effects if an illumination effect pattern is not previously determined and the shape of the effect face changes rapidly is provided. An image special effect apparatus 100 for adding an illumination effect using light from a light source when viewed from an arbitrary eye point in a face having a curved face to image information concerning an input image and outputting a video signal provided by mapping the image information to the face generates a normal vector at a position of the face based on rectangular coordinate data and the shape of the face, a normal vector generation section 110, generates reflectivity of the light in an eye point direction by calculation of A (2(L·N)N?2L)·V of an expression using the normal vector, a light source direction unit vector, an eye point vector V, and an arbitrary value A, and creates the image information based on the image and the reflectivity.Type: GrantFiled: March 9, 2007Date of Patent: May 15, 2012Assignee: Panasonic CorporationInventors: Kazuhiro Tsubota, Hiroyuki Izumi

Patent number: 6230136Abstract: To decode voice data coded in a coding system on a specific standard (for example, ADPCM or a different standard), the voice data is previously sorted by a data sorter 102 and is stored in a second data storage 103. Voice data read from a third data storage 105 is decoded by a decoder 107 and is converted from parallel data into serial data by a parallel/serial data converter 109. The resultant data is transferred to a D/A converter, whereby the voice data coded on one standard and the voice data coded on a different standard can be decoded and transferred to the D/A converter by circuit change on a small scale without the need for a separate voice control system for each coding system.Type: GrantFiled: December 2, 1998Date of Patent: May 8, 2001Assignee: Matsushita Electric Industrial Co., Ltd.Inventors: Eiji Yamamoto, Kazuhiro Tsubota
